Shev Yaakov. First edition Frankfurt 1742.
Halachic responsa of R. Yaakov Poprush. Two parts.
R. Yaakov Ha’Cohen Katz-Poprush (died 1740) was one of the most the eminent rabbinical leaders of his era. He served as a Dayan in Prague and later Rav in Koblenz. Following the passing of R. Avrohom Brodie he was appointed to the distinguished position of Rav of Frankfurt. He served in Frankfurt until his passing, upon which he was succeeded by R. Yaakov Yehoshua (Pnei Yehoshua). Enthusiastically received, this sefer is quoted extensively by the later commentators.
Vinograd Frankfurt 497. Kranau press. 1, 109, 1, 139 pages. 33 cm (first title page 31 cm). Fine condition. Antique binding, leather spine.
